What is APY?

APY (Annual Percentage Yield) represents the real rate of return earned on an investment, considering the effect of compounding interest. It provides a clearer picture of your actual returns compared to a simple interest rate.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

What is the difference between APY and interest rate? APY considers the compounding of interest, while the interest rate is the simple annual rate.

How often is APY calculated? APY is typically calculated yearly, but it can also be calculated for shorter periods, depending on the frequency of compounding.

Why is compounding frequency important? The more frequently interest is compounded, the higher the APY will be, as interest is calculated and added to the principal more often.
